Disadvantages of subsidary books are:- 1. they may be expensive in case of a small business as in a small bbusiness it is best to keep journal. 2. it requires some basic knowledge of accountancy as if any of the entries are recorded incorrect then it will be a problem or they need to be rectified.

The disadvantages of computer accounting are that it is subject to the same flaws as all data stored on a computer, such as crashes, memory wipes, accidental deletion and hacking.
